85048 Market Overview

Houses

Highlights

As of February 7, 2025, the single-family homes market in 85048 shows notable shifts that reflect broader trends within the real estate landscape.

  • Active listings have decreased to 65, down from 82 three months ago, suggesting diminished supply.
  • The average days on market (DOM) for active listings is currently at 73 days, reflecting a slight improvement from 92 DOM three months ago.
  • The months of inventory have risen to 5.3 months, indicating a more balanced market.
  • Sold prices have increased significantly, currently averaging $851,467, a marked jump from $750,996 three months prior, reinforcing a positive buyer sentiment in this area.

Living in 85048

  • Community and Scenery: The 85048 zip code provides a harmonious blend of suburban convenience and natural beauty, making it a top choice for families, professionals, and retirees seeking a quality lifestyle. South Mountain provides a beautiful natural backdrop to many of the neighborhoods here.
  • Active Lifestyle: Residents of 85048 enjoy easy access to South Mountain Park, where hiking, mountain biking, and other outdoor activities are popular year-round. Parks and green spaces add to the community’s outdoor appeal.
  • Weather: With a warm desert climate, 85048 is ideal for those who enjoy sunny days and mild winters, with most properties built to make the most of outdoor living.

Schools in 85048

  • Kyrene School District: The 85048 area is part of the highly rated Kyrene School District, with schools that emphasize strong academics, community involvement, and active parent participation.
  • High School Options: Students in 85048 typically attend Desert Vista High School, known for its academic rigor, arts, and sports programs.
  • Charter and Private School Choices: Additional educational options include various charter and private schools, offering specialized programs that meet diverse learning needs.

Lifestyle in 85048

  • Recreation and Parks: Local parks, such as Vista Canyon Park, offer sports fields, playgrounds, and picnic spots for family gatherings and outdoor activities. The area’s close proximity to golf courses and community centers enhances the recreational lifestyle.
  • Shopping and Dining Options: The area has convenient access to shops, restaurants, and services, with larger retail centers located nearby in Chandler and Tempe for expanded options.

Proximity to Amenities in 85048

  • Transportation: The 85048 zip code has convenient access to the Loop 202 and I-10, making it easy for commuters and those traveling within the Valley.
  • Medical Facilities: Quality healthcare facilities are nearby, with local hospitals and clinics ensuring excellent medical care for residents in 85048.

Real Estate in 85048

  • Home Types: Homes for sale in 85048 offer a variety of options, including single-family homes, condos, and luxury properties in gated communities. Many homes come with features like desert landscaping and outdoor living areas.
  • Price Range: Real estate prices in 85048 vary, offering options across different budgets, with many properties featuring upscale amenities and desert landscaping.
  • Market Trends: The demand for homes in 85048 remains high due to its excellent schools, community feel, and proximity to natural attractions, making it a sought-after market for homebuyers.

An In-Depth Look at 85048 Houses

The single-family homes market in 85048 displayed several key trends driven by changing dynamics over the past several months. As of now, the total number of active listings has declined to 65, which is 17 fewer than the 82 reported three months ago. This significant drop suggests a tightening supply, though the current inventory level remains consistent with seasonal norms for this period.

In terms of days on market (DOM), properties in 85048 are now averaging 73 days on market, reflecting a decrease from 92 days three months prior. This reduction indicates a slight acceleration in sales and suggests that buyers are responding favorably to listings, perhaps due to competitive pricing or desirable features.

Moreover, the months of inventory have climbed to 5.3 months, a rise that suggests a leveling off in the market. However, while this number points to a more balanced market—where neither buyers nor sellers hold a distinct advantage—the total inventory levels remain healthy from a historical perspective. Comparing this to six months ago, when the reading was notably lower at 2.5 months, we see that market conditions have shifted, and the increase can be attributed to the slowing pace of sales or a seasonal adjustment in the number of active listings.

Analyzing sold prices, they have increased to an average of $851,467, demonstrating a significant rise compared to the $750,996 recorded three months ago. Such growth in sold prices suggests a robust buyer confidence, possibly influenced by low interest rates and competitive market conditions.

Additionally, the average price per square foot for sold properties was recorded at $304, consistent with fluctuations from recent months, while active listings show an average price per square foot slightly higher at $316. This disparity suggests that as homes are sold, buyers are often willing to meet or exceed pricing expectations.

As we look towards the upcoming months, market participants—both buyers and sellers—should consider these trends, especially the increased days on market and rising prices, which may give buyers more negotiating power. Nonetheless, the strengthening sold price metric reinforces a favorable environment for sellers looking to capitalize on current market conditions. Thus, strategy will be key for all parties involved as they navigate these changing dynamics in 85048.
